Transaction 16ae71f2bf92642eb2ba911f39d89cdafed4d813831836b2ee303f4bc79cd645

1 Input
1 Outputs
  • 16ae71f2bf92642eb2ba911f39d89cdafed4d813831836b2ee303f4bc79cd645:0
  • value  2500000010
    address  n2U7mXV4HFumkKLt7jz8LhNqKHMszTP39c